dhcp: NULL pointer dereference crash via crafted DHCPv6 packet
ISC DHCP server 4.0 before 4.0.2, 4.1 before 4.1.2, and 4.2 before 4.2.0-P1 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service NULL pointer dereference and crash via a DHCPv6 packet containing a Relay-Forward message without an address in the Relay-Forward link-address field...

isc-dhcp-server -- Empty link-address denial of service
ISC reports: If the server receives a DHCPv6 packet containing one or more Relay-Forward messages, and none of them supply an address in the Relay-Forward link-address field, then the server will crash. This can be used as a single packet crash attack vector...

CVE-2010-3696
The frdhcpdecode function in lib/dhcp.c in FreeRADIUS 2.1.9, in certain non-default builds, does not properly handle the DHCP Relay Agent Information option,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service infinite loop and daemon outage via a packet that has more than one sub-option...
